What is a spark arrestor and why it matters
Spark arrestors are screens installed in the exhaust path of generators to trap or cool hot embers before they exit the exhaust. They protect your property from grass, leaves, or debris that could ignite if embers escape. According to Genset Cost, regular cleaning improves airflow and protects engine efficiency while extending the life of the exhaust system. The spark arrestor can accumulate soot, ash, and grime from exhaust gas and unburnt fuel, which gradually reduces exhaust flow and can cause overheating if neglected. In dry, windy, or dusty environments, buildup happens faster, so a proactive cleaning routine is especially beneficial. Always consult your generator’s manual for any manufacturer-specific guidance or screen replacement intervals.
The Genset Cost team found that a well-maintained spark arrestor not only reduces fire risk but also helps maintain consistent engine performance during power outages. Keeping a routine of inspection and cleaning simplifies maintenance schedules and minimizes unexpected downtime. A clean arrestor also reduces back pressure, which can improve fuel efficiency and reduce wear on exhaust components. Remember: safety first, and never bypass a damaged screen.
Signs your spark arrestor needs cleaning
A clean spark arrestor ensures optimal exhaust flow and minimizes fire risk. Look for these signs that indicate it’s time to clean:
- Thick black smoke or visible heavy sooty buildup around the exhaust
- Reduced engine performance or a noticeable loss of power under load
- Warped or damaged screen edges, or signs of corrosion
- Sluggish exhaust flow or a rattling sound from the exhaust path
- New or recurring spicy or burnt smell from the exhaust gases
If you notice any of these, schedule a cleaning session promptly. Regular inspections help catch issues before they become costly repairs. Even with rare usage, environmental exposure like dusty roads or wildfire smoke can accelerate buildup. The goal is to maintain a clear path for exhaust and prevent embers from escaping.
Safety first: preparing to clean
Before touching any part of the exhaust system, ensure the generator is fully powered down and cooled. Work in a well-ventilated area away from flammable materials and never perform maintenance indoors. Wear appropriate PPE: safety glasses, heat-resistant gloves, and a long-sleeved shirt to shield your skin from hot metal or sharp edges. Have a flashlight to inspect tight spaces, and keep a container or bag ready for a removed screen. Disconnect any battery or fuel connections only if you know how to do so safely from the manual. This preparation reduces burn risk and ensures you can perform a thorough inspection after cleaning. Always follow the manufacturer’s safety warnings and local regulations, especially in fire-prone regions.

Inspecting after cleaning and preventive checks
Once you’ve cleaned the arrestor and reinstalled it, perform a quick but thorough inspection. Check for any residual debris in the exhaust path, verify the arrestor sits flush against its mounting seat, and confirm there are no loose fasteners. Look for signs of heat damage or discoloration around the screen frame, which can indicate overheating or back pressure issues. If you find damage, replace the screen rather than attempting a patch. Also, record the cleaning event in your maintenance log, including date and any observations about performance. Establishing a routine inspection cadence helps you catch issues early and extend the life of your generator.
Common mistakes and when to replace parts
Common mistakes include using lubricants on the screen, applying excessive force with tools, or reusing a damaged arrestor. Never force the screen through a tight fitting or reassemble a damaged frame. If the screen shows holes, tears, or corrosion, replace it. Replacement screens should match the original model specifications; consult the manual or the manufacturer for the correct part. Finally, avoid cleaning during active operation or in wet conditions, which can lead to electric shock or short circuits. Replacement parts are a prudent investment to maintain safety and reliability.
Maintenance schedule and records
Set a maintenance cadence that matches your usage and environment. For heavy use or dusty environments, check and clean the spark arrestor monthly or after long periods of operation. For light use, quarterly inspections may suffice, with a full clean every 6–12 months. Maintain a simple log: date, condition of the arrestor, any parts replaced, and tests performed. A written record helps track when to replace screens and aligns with warranties or service agreements. Regular maintenance reduces the risk of fuel inefficiency and unexpected outages during critical power needs.

Steps
Estimated time: 30-45 minutes
- 1
Power down and let cool
Shut off the generator and allow the exhaust area to cool completely. This prevents burns and reduces the risk of igniting any flammable residue. If you must work in a warm environment, give it at least 15–20 minutes of cooling time, longer in hot climates.
Tip: Always verify the unit is unplugged from any power source before you begin. - 2
Open access cover and locate arrestor
Remove the external cover or guard that blocks access to the exhaust path. Use the screwdriver as needed to unscrew fasteners. Once exposed, visually locate the spark arrestor screen inside the exhaust throat.
Tip: Keep screws in a labeled container so you don’t lose them. - 3
Remove and assess the screen
Carefully lift the arrestor screen out of its seat. Inspect for holes, tears, corrosion, or bending. If the frame is damaged, replace the entire screen rather than attempting a patch.
Tip: If the screen is stuck, pause and consult the manual to avoid damaging seals. - 4
Clean the screen surface
Using a stiff wire brush, loosen adherent soot and embers. Lightly wipe with a soft cloth to remove remaining grime. For stubborn residues, a small amount of degreaser can help, but avoid soaking the screen.
Tip: Never use metal tools that could scratch or puncture the screen. - 5
Reinstall and secure
Place the screen back into its seat and reattach the guard. Ensure it sits flush with no gaps and that all fasteners are tight but not over-torqued. A loose cover can allow debris entry or cause vibration damage.
Tip: Double-check alignment before starting the unit. - 6
Test run and inspect
Start the generator at idle and observe the exhaust for a smooth flow. Listen for unusual noises and check for vibrations around the housing. If any issues arise, power down and recheck installation or seek professional service.
Tip: Monitor for 5–10 minutes during the first post-clean run to confirm stability.

How often should I clean a generator spark arrestor?
Cleaning frequency depends on usage and environment. Inspect monthly and clean every 3–6 months in moderate conditions; more frequent cleaning may be needed in dusty or wildfire-prone areas.

Is a spark arrestor required by code?
Regulations vary by region. Some areas require arrestors on generators, especially in wildfire-prone zones, while others set guidelines for maintenance and replacement.

Should I lubricate the arrestor or screen?
Lubricants should not be applied to the screen or inside the exhaust; oil can gum up the surface and attract grime.
